During the first two to three days after Rhinoplasty surgery, the face will feel puffy, the nose may ache, and you may experience a dull headache. You should plan on resting with your head elevated for the first couple of days. There will be swelling and bruising around the eyes, reaching a peak after four days. Some patients also get very swollen lips and cheeks including difficulty smiling. All these symptoms will subside within 3 weeks of the nose procedure.
By the end of one week all nasal packing, dressings, internal and external splints and stitches from the Rhinoplasty should be removed. You will feel substantially better in your second week of recovery.
